Python 3: Selecting random pair elements from a numpy array without repetition
我想在每个循环中从总体数组中选择随机对元素,而无需重复。
在我的代码中,我创建了一个填充数组,然后将其传递给选择函数,在该函数中,我将在每个循环中生成两个随机索引号,并基于此,从填充数组中选择对元素。
因此,如果人口总数为5,则结果大小将为10,因为在每个循环中,我将得到两个元素。
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 | import random import numpy as np population_size = 5 dimension= 2 upper = 1 lower = 0 pair_loop = 1 pair_size = 2 def select (pop parents = np.zeros((0, dimension), dtype=np.float_) for i in range (population_size): for ii in range (pair_loop): random_index= np.random.randint (population_size, size=(pair_size)) parents = np.vstack((parents, population[random_index,])) print (i ,"random_index", random_index) print (parents) return (parents) population = np.random.choice(np.linspace(lower, upper, 10), size=(population_size,dimension), replace=True) parents = select(population) |
我想得到两个不同的元素,我不想重复相同的索引号,
例如,如果我有:[2,4]
我不想再次看到[2,4]或[4,2]
任何建议将不胜感激
使用以下命令创建索引列表:
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 | import itertools, random def select(size, pair_size): g =itertools.combinations(range(size),pair_size) alist = list(g) random.shuffle(alist) return alist In [42]: alist = select(5,2) In [43]: alist Out[43]: [(0, 3), (1, 3), (2, 3), (0, 2), (0, 4), (3, 4), (0, 1), (2, 4), (1, 2), (1, 4)] |
并将其应用于您的人群:
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 | In [44]: population = np.random.choice(np.arange(10,20), size=(5,2), replace=Tru ...: e) In [45]: population Out[45]: array([[18, 19], [16, 17], [10, 11], [10, 15], [14, 15]]) In [46]: population[alist,] Out[46]: array([[[18, 19], [10, 15]], [[16, 17], [10, 15]], [[10, 11], [10, 15]], [[18, 19], [10, 11]], [[18, 19], [14, 15]], [[10, 15], [14, 15]], [[18, 19], [16, 17]], [[10, 11], [14, 15]], [[16, 17], [10, 11]], [[16, 17], [14, 15]]]) |
为避免重复生成整个索引集,请对其进行随机排序,然后从随机组合中弹出对索引值。 例如:
1 2 3 4 5 6 7 8 9 10 11 | import random def pair_generator(population_size): pop_range = 2 * population_size population = [i for i in range(1, pop_range + 1)] random.shuffle(population) for _ in range(population_size): yield [population.pop(), population.pop()] population_size = 5 print([pair for pair in pair_generator(population_size)]) |
这是基于生成器的,因此您可以生成任意数量的对,最多可以生成整个对。
